Derrick Peterson (born November 28, 1977 in Waycross, Georgia) is a retired American middle-distance runner who specialized in the 800 meters. He represented his country at the 2004 Summer Olympics without reaching the semifinals. He won the silver medal in the event at the 2001 Summer Universiade and the bronze at the 1999 Summer Universiade.He is now the assistant coach of long sprints and hurdles at his alma matter, the University of Missouri.
